Groovy Urpa 3 is a bold, narrow, medium contrast, upright, normal x-height font.

A heavy, compact serif with lively, uneven contours and prominent flared terminals. Strokes swell and pinch with a hand-cut, wavy rhythm rather than strict geometric regularity, creating chunky bowls and tapered joins. Serifs are blunt and splayed, often wedge-like, and the interior counters are slightly irregular, adding a subtly organic texture. Overall proportions feel condensed with tight sidebearings, while letter widths vary noticeably across the set for a bouncy, animated line color.
This font works best for display use such as posters, headlines, event promotions, album/playlist art, packaging, and expressive brand marks. It can also fit short pull quotes or section headers where a retro, playful voice is desired, especially at medium-to-large sizes.
The overall tone is upbeat and nostalgic, with a distinctly retro, poster-like energy. Its soft, blobby modulation and flaring details suggest a fun, slightly mischievous personality that reads as decorative and attention-seeking rather than formal.
The design appears intended to evoke a vintage, groovy display feel through exaggerated flares, soft wedges, and intentionally irregular stroke contours. It prioritizes character and visual rhythm over neutrality, aiming to create immediate personality and period flavor in titles and branding.
The sample text shows strong word shape and a consistent dark color, but the irregular outlines and compact spacing make it better suited to larger sizes where the quirky terminals and counters remain clear. Numerals match the same chunky, flared construction, supporting cohesive display typography.
